Ordinals
beta
Address 3KdkaGd6xFyUR3Gxz5jK74R8C8Uvk8wA9w
sat balance
29279
outputs
1bf75b93d522853f199ac0c16bce111ac84bd6dd914ae5b7d57253715a2652f7:1